  • We carried out a set of simulations to reproduce the performance of wide-field NEO surveys based on the revised population model of Near Earth Objects (NEOs) constructed by Morbidelli (2006). This is the first time where the new model is carefully compared with discovery statistics, and with the exception of population model, the simulation is identical to the procedure described in Moon et al. (2008). Our simulations show rather large discrepancy between the number of NEO discoveries made by the actual and the simulated surveys. First of all, unlike Bottke et al. (2002)'s, Morbidelli (2006)'s population model overestimates the number of NEOs. However, the latter reproduces orbit distributions of the actual population better. Our analysis suggests that both models significantly underestimate Amors, while overestimating the number of Apollos. Our simulation result implies that substantial modifications of both models are needed for more accurate reproduction of survey observations. We also identify Hungaria region (HU) to be one of the most convincing candidates that supply a large fraction of asteroids to the inner Solar System.

  • Based on the 4 principal research-performance criteria in 28 national universities in Korea, both cluster analysis and multidimensional scaling are performed in this paper. We can classify and/or specialize the initially unknown groups into a group of relatively homogeneous universities and then create new groupings without any preconceived notion of what clusters may arise. Furthermore, the level of similarity of individual universities can be visualized on the multidimensional space so that each university is then assigned coordinates in each of the 2 dimensions. Both types and characteristics of each university can be relatively evaluated and be practically exploited for the policy of the university authority through these results.

  • This paper describes error resilient coding scheme is added in WLL system and its application for robust low-bit rate still image transmission over power controlled W-CDA system Rayleigh fading channels. The baseline JPEG compressing methods are uses in image coding over wireless channel. The channel uses Reed-Solomon(RS) outer codes concatenated with convolutional inner codes, and truncated type I hybrid ARQ protocol based on the selective repeat strategy and the RS error detection capability. Simulation results are proved for the statistics of the frame-error bursts of the proposed system in comparison with conventional WLL system. it gains the 2 dB of the Eb/No in same BER.

Beyond robust design: an example of synergy between statistics and advanced engineering design

  • Higher efficiency and effectiveness of Research & Development phases can be attained using advanced statistical methodologies. In this work statistical methodologies are combined with a deterministic approach to engineering design. In order to show the potentiality of such integration, a simple but effective example is presented. It concerns the problem of optimising the performances of a paper helicopter. The design of this simple device is not new in quality engineering literature and has been mainly used for educational purposes. Taking full advantage of fundamental engineering knowledge, an aerodynamic model is originally formulated in order to describe the flight of the helicopter. Screening experiments were necessary to get first estimates of model parameters. Subsequently, deterministic evaluations based on this model were necessary to set up further experimental phases needed to search (or a better design. Thanks to this integration of statistical and deterministic phases, a significant performance improvement is obtained. Moreover, the engineering knowledge かms out to be developed since an explanation of the “why” of better performances, although approximate, is achieved. The final design solution is robust in a broader sense, being both validated by experimental evidence and closely examined by engineering knowledge.

SD-WLB: An SDN-aided mechanism for web load balancing based on server statistics

  • Software-defined networking (SDN) is a modern approach for current computer and data networks. The increase in the number of business websites has resulted in an exponential growth in web traffic. To cope with the increased demands, multiple web servers with a front-end load balancer are widely used by organizations and businesses as a viable solution to improve the performance. In this paper, we propose a load-balancing mechanism for SDN. Our approach allocates web requests to each server according to its response time and the traffic volume of the corresponding switch port. The centralized SDN controller periodically collects this information to maintain an up-to-date view of the load distribution among the servers, and incoming user requests are redirected to the most appropriate server. The simulation results confirm the superiority of our approach compared to several other techniques. Compared to LBBSRT, round robin, and random selection methods, our mechanism improves the average response time by 19.58%, 33.94%, and 57.41%, respectively. Furthermore, the average improvement of throughput in comparison with these algorithms is 16.52%, 29.72%, and 58.27%, respectively.

Combining Hough Transform and Fuzzy Unsupervised Learning Strategy in Automatic Segmentation of Large Bowel Obstruction Area from Erect Abdominal Radiographs

  • The number of senior citizens with large bowel obstruction is steadily growing in Korea. Plain radiography was used to examine the severity and treatment of this phenomenon. To avoid examiner subjectivity in radiography readings, we propose an automatic segmentation method to identify fluid-filled areas indicative of large bowel obstruction. Our proposed method applies the Hough transform to locate suspicious areas successfully and applies the possibilistic fuzzy c-means unsupervised learning algorithm to form the target area in a noisy environment. In an experiment with 104 real-world large-bowel obstruction radiographs, the proposed method successfully identified all suspicious areas in 73 of 104 input images and partially identified the target area in another 21 images. Additionally, the proposed method shows a true-positive rate of over 91% and false-positive rate of less than 3% for pixel-level area formation. These performance evaluation statistics are significantly better than those of the possibilistic c-means and fuzzy c-means-based strategies; thus, this hybrid strategy of automatic segmentation of large bowel suspicious areas is successful and might be feasible for real-world use.

Factors Influencing Resilience of Nursing Students: Focusing on Emotional Intelligence and Nursing Professionalism (간호대학생의 회복탄력성 영향 요인: 감성지능과 간호전문직관 중심으로)

  • Purpose: The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ship between emotional intelligence, nursing professionalism, and resilience of nursing students and to identify the factors affecting resilience of nursing students. Methods: Data were collected from 205 nursing students in the 1st, 2nd, and 3rd grades of nursing colleges located in J province, and a survey was conducted from November 20th to November 30th, 2023. The collected data were analyzed through descriptive statistics, t-test, one-way ANOVA, Scheffe test, Pearson's correlation coefficient, and stepwise multiple regression analysis using SPSS/WIN 29.0 program. Result: The emotional intelligence of the subjects showed a significant positive correlation with nursing professionalism(r=.56 p<.001) and resilience(r=.75, p<.001), and nursing professionalism showed a significant positive correlation with resilience(r=.55, p<.001). The major factors influencing the resilience of nursing students were emotional intelligence, nursing professionalism, academic performance, and personality in order, and their explanatory power was 62% (F=83.05 p<.001). Conclusion: Based on the results of this study, it is necessary to develop an educational program that improves emotional intelligence and nursing professionalism in order to strengthen the resilience of nursing students.

A Survey on Situation-related Communication Educational Needs for Novice Intensive Care Unit Nurses (중환자실 신규 간호사의 의사소통 상황 관련 교육 요구도 조사)

  • Purpose : This study sought to investigate novice nurses' communication education needs in the intensive care unit (ICU) using Importance-Performance Analysis (IPA) and Borich's need assessment model. This study identified communication challenges in clinical settings to develop a simulation program that enhances communication competencies based on educational requirements. Methods : A descriptive research design and a self-report questionnaire were used. The latter was developed and administered to 121 novice nurses with less than one year of experience in the ICU at various university hospitals in Korea. Data were collected via the online open chatroom from June 24th to July 28th, 2023. The communication education needs were identified using descriptive statistics, t-tests, IPA, and Borich's needs assessment model. Text analysis was used to categorize the participants' communication experience. Results : The results revealed that "communication with physicians," "communication with patients," and "communication with nurse on another shift" domains contained the most substantial educational needs for novice nurses working in the intensive care units. Conclusion : The results provide fundamental data for developing and enhancing customized communication education programs for novice ICU nurses. This valuable information could help ICU nurses and educators improve new nurses' communication skills, which would ultimately contribute to the advancement of nursing education and clinical practice.
